Diabetes Education Program
Wood County Hospital offers comprehensive programs for the management of diabetes provided by registered nurses and specially trained registered dietitians. The Diabetes Education Program assists patients in diabetes self-management and continuing education for the diabetic population of the surrounding area.

The Diabetes Education program is recognized by the American Diabetes Association (www.diabetes.org)  (Medicare Certified).  Patients are instructed on modified diets, blood glucose monitoring, management tools, nutrition and meal planning, physical activity planning, medications, self-care do’s and don'ts, stress management, and mental wellness. Education is also available for pregnant women with gestational diabetes.

 

The health care team includes a physician, nurse educator and dietitian.  The keys to good diabetes management are enlisting the help of your team and working together to reach your goals. For more information, call (419) 354-8863.

Diabetes Interest Group

The Diabetes Interest Group at Wood County Hospital meets monthly to discuss current topics about diabetes.  The meetings are held on the second Thursday of the month, September through May from 12:30 to 1:30 P.M. in the hospital meeting rooms. The meetings are free and open to the public.
